Output 503558554d093c99c8385bc1fb6e130c2f283a3ccf250217b15cdf02e292d5ea:1

value
1570520
script pubkey
OP_0 OP_PUSHBYTES_20 584e44c2c582013faabcbc48df78ead645f3eca1
address
ltc1qtp8yfsk9sgqnl24uh3yd77826ezl8m9p5jcypw
transaction
503558554d093c99c8385bc1fb6e130c2f283a3ccf250217b15cdf02e292d5ea
spent
true